NView Taskswitcher problems
When I try to use the NView Taskswitcher instead of the WinXP native
task switcher, it doesn't work properly. This always happens: If an application has a subwindow or dialog box up, using the NView task switcher ignores it and places the focus on the main window. This makes it impossible to use the keyboard to deal with the subwindow or dialog, because the focus is not on it and there is no way to navigate to it without the mouse. The native task switcher places the focus on the dialog or subwindow, because that is the "front" of the program. This often happens: The NView task switcher indicates that it's switching the system focus to an application, but doesn't. The focus remains on the prior selected program. I've only seen this happen if the programs are stacked on the display. WinXP Pro SP2, MSI/nVidia GeForce 7300 GS using the included nVidia drivers and utilities. Two monitors (one analog, one digital) set to horizontal span. I'm trying to use the NView task switcher because it stays fully within one display, whereas the native one is always centered - spanning the gap between the monitors. -- Jeffrey Kaplan www.gordol.org The from userid is killfiled Send personal mail to gordol Tips for the Innocent Bystander: 42.
